Originally released in 1969. The Erasers is a crime/mystery film. directed by Lucien Deroisy. At just 84 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.

Starring Françoise Brion, Claude Titre, and André Gevrey

Synopsis

A detective is seeking an assassin in a murder that has not yet occurred, only to discover that it is his destiny to become that assassin.
